licenceNew report released on the global bio‑based polymer market 2023 – a deep and comprehensive insight into a dynamically growing market
The year 2023 was a promising year for bio‑based polymers: PLA capacities have been increased by almost 50 %, and at the same time polyamide capacities are steadily increasing, as well as epoxy resin production. Capacities for 100 % bio-based PE have been expanded and PE and PP made from bio‑based naphtha are being further established with growing volumes. Current and future expansions for PHAs are still on the horizon. After hinting at a comeback in 2022 bio-based PET production dropped in 2023 by 50 %.

DownloadsThis document contains a generic set of slides to introduce the concept of renewable carbon and the Renewable Carbon Initiative. The focus of this webinar was the latest scientific background report: “Non-level Playing Field for Renewable Materials vs. Fossil in Life Cycle Assessments – Critical aspects of the JRC Plastics LCA methodology and its policy implications”.
In addition, three RCI member companies shared their expertise on renewable carbon, defossilisation and sustainable carbon cycles.
AllocNow (speaker: Daniel Bochnitschek) talked about how the increasing demand for sustainable and low carbon products is driving the need for specific and comprehensive information on product carbon footprints. AllocNow discussed why standardisation of sustainability accounting methodologies is critical and how a data-driven approach can help create transparency at scale.
Econic Technologies Ltd. (speaker: Liz Manning) spoke about the opportunities and challenges of quantifying the sustainability impact of key products in complex manufacturing supply chains.
SCS Global Services (speakers: Miguel Ruiz and Jéssica Marcon Bressanin) highlighted its certification activities, focusing on biofuels and circular materials schemes, as well as greenhouse gas accounting methodologies.

licenceAdvanced recycling technologies are developing at a fast pace, with new players constantly appearing on the market, from start-ups to giants and everything in between – new plants are being built, new capacities are being achieved, and new partnerships are established. Due to these developments, it is difficult to keep track of everything. The report “Mapping of advanced plastic waste recycling technologies and their global capacities” aims to clear up this jungle of information providing a structured, in-depth overview and insight. It has an exclusive focus on profiling available technologies and providers of advanced recycling including the addition of new technologies and updated/revised profiles. Furthermore, for the first time a comprehensive evaluation of the global input and output capacities was carried out for which more than 340 planned as well as installed and operating plants including their specific product yields were mapped.
Further information:
The new report “Mapping of advanced plastic waste recycling technologies and their global capacities” differs from the old report “Chemical Recycling – Status, Trends and Challenges” as follows:- All technology provider profiles from the old report included + updated to 2023.
- Overall >120 technologies and providers (vs. >70 technologies and providers in the old report)
- Global capacities
In summary, this report is suitable for interested readers who have already dealt with the advanced recycling topic and are looking for an up-to-date overview of all identified providers and a detailed description of the technologies.

DownloadsIn a comprehensive member survey in summer 2023, the Renewable Carbon Initiative (RCI) has collected ideas and opinions on what is needed to enable the transition from fossil to renewable carbon in Europe. The feedback paints a clear picture and is a call to action.
The European chemicals and materials sector is under pressure. RCI members, representing a wide range of these sectors, see many common elements in the key challenges and how to address them. High energy and raw material prices, as well as the need to defossilise carbon demand to meet CO2 emission targets, particularly in so-called “Scope 3” emissions, are some of the issues frequently raised.
